MySql技巧之REPLACE INTO

来源:互联网 发布:开核软件 编辑:程序博客网 时间:2024/06/13 11:24

       很多时候我们希望判断一条记录是否已存在,存在的话就更新,不存在就插入! 通常的做法是写一条 IF Exist 做判断,但现在MySql给我们提供了更直接的语句就是REPLACE  INTO!

REPLACE  INTO的语法跟INSERT INTO类似:

             REPLACE INTO b_history(

    字段名1,字段名2.……

   )

   VALUES

    (

   数据1,数据…………

    )

      当然需要注意一点他是根据主键字段更新的,即主键字段一至则更新否则添加

0 0
原创粉丝点击